And Then There Were None (1974)
Ten people are invited to a hotel in the Iranian desert, only to find that an unseen person is killing them one by one. Could one of them be the killer?

And Then There Were None (1974) turns Agatha Christie’s clockwork mystery into a sun-bleached nightmare, using the vast Iranian desert and the haunting ruins near Persepolis to make every footstep feel like it echoes into nowhere. Peter Collinson stages the suspense with sly, anxious camerawork—off-kilter framings and watchful angles that keep you scanning the edges of the frame, as if the film itself suspects someone. The cast, led by a rugged Oliver Reed and a coolly compelling Elke Sommer, brings a sharp, adult bite to the paranoia as manners crumble and accusations curdle into fear. If you want a cozy whodunit, this one’s too dry, cruel, and tense for comfort—but if you like your mysteries stylish, atmospheric, and steadily tightening the vise, it’s a wonderfully unnerving ride.
This 1974 take on Agatha Christie is clearly aiming for sun-baked, exotic suspense: ten strangers trapped in an isolated Iranian desert hotel while an unseen killer ticks them off one by one. The problem is it often feels more impressed with its scenery and concept than with tension, character interplay, or cleanly staged murders, so the mystery can land flat instead of gripping. If you want a faithful Christie puzzle with sharp pacing and a satisfying, uncompromised payoff, the altered setting and softened ending may feel like a cheat. Still, if you can treat it as a vintage, star-studded travelogue-thriller with a morbid nursery-rhyme hook and you’re patient with uneven energy, there’s some atmospheric curiosity value here.
